Letter: Pizza Numbers Don’t Add Up

I was saddened by the article on July 4 describing how Mr. Jim Hightower, the owner of four local Domino’s Pizza franchises, was potentially impacted by the upcoming Obamacare. The article quoted Mr. Hightower, who I believe is a proud Reagan Republican, saying that, “if he was forced to provide much needed health care for his 80 hard working employees, he would have to raise the price of his pizzas from $6 to $15” — in other words, $9 per pizza. You will have to forgive me, but I’ve always been good at two things: 1) Understanding numbers and the relationship of different numbers; and 2) When someone might be using numbers to make an argument that only works with people who aren’t good at numbers/Harry Duff of Coeur d'Alene, letter to the Coeur d'Alene Press editor.
